I’m a pretty die hard Starbucks dude so sitting at Coffee Bean is like trying out another religious denomination. This place is a gem of a coffee shop on Myrtle Street and an excellent and convenient starting point on any venture into Old Town Monrovia. (Plus, it’s a great place to park, grab a coffee and then explore the rest of Old Town Monrovia, especially on Friday Nights when they have their Farmers Market and parking is tough.) My favorite spot is the long communal table. It’s always empty, at least whenever I’m there and gets all the best sunlight if you’re there at just the right time during the late afternoon. Though this may be a pain point for the store(because businesses want business), this is a great place to lounge, read or study because it never gets overly crowded and chaotic like most Starbucks stores. With many residences that are adjacent to the store, and Old Town Monrovia down the street, a lot of regulars frequent this place which explains why the baristas are so genuinely nice and are great with remembering your name. True, they wrote it on my drink but when they announced«James! Red Eye with an add shot!» It felt like the relationship could have been something more. I’m trying to be funny and I can tell it’s not working so I’ll stop before this gets blind date creepy. WI-FI: Pretty solid. They have a code that is displayed on their mounted flat screen TV. Pretty convenient. You will have to log in again after 2 hours so periodically save your work. ADJACENT: Von’s, Yogurtland, Blaze Pizza, Urbane Salon, and Old Town Monrovia. TIP: Don’t make a joke about Starbucks when ordering. The baristas get that all the time. It’s like going on a date with a brunette and joking on about your preference for blondes.
